Abstract

A kind of discarded chalk end recycling equipment of environmental protection, including bottom plate, the support device being set on the bottom plate, the electric cylinders device, electric machine, the frame device above the bottom plate that are set in the support device.The present invention can adequately grind discarded chalk end so that the effect of grinding is good, and can collect the chalk dust after grinding automatically so that the intensity of hand labor is small, suitable for promoting.

Background technology
The recovery processing of discarded chalk end can not only reduce the pollution of environment, but also resource can be made to obtain repeating profit With extremely meeting the relevant environmental policy in China.However discarded chalk end processing equipment on the market cannot carry out chalk end Adequately grinding so that the effect of grinding is bad, and cannot automatically collect the chalk dust after grinding so that hand labor Intensity is big, it is difficult to promote.
Therefore, it is necessary to provide a kind of new technical solution to overcome drawbacks described above.

Specific implementation mode
Clearly complete explanation is made to the discarded chalk end recycling equipment of environmental protection of the invention below in conjunction with attached drawing.
As shown in Figure 1, the discarded chalk end recycling equipment of present invention environmental protection includes bottom plate 1, is set to the bottom plate 1 On support device 2, be set in the support device 2 electric cylinders device 3, electric machine 4, above the bottom plate 1 Frame device 5.
As shown in Figure 1, the bottom plate 1 is equipped with the collection center 11 being positioned above.The bottom plate 1 is cuboid and level It places.The collection center 11 is hollow cuboid, and the upper end of the collection center 11 is provided with opening so that the collection center 11 Longitudinal section be concave shape, the collection center 11 is placed on the upper surface of the bottom plate 1, and the chalk dust after grinding concentrates on institute It states in collection center 11.
As shown in Figure 1, the support device 2 includes supporting rod 21, the holder 22 that is set to the right side of the supporting rod 21, is set Be placed on the holder 22 first smooth piece 23, the first support plate 24 for being set to 21 top of the supporting rod, be set to institute State second support plate 25 on 22 right side of holder.The supporting rod 21 is vertical bar, the lower end of the supporting rod 21 and the bottom plate 1 Upper surface be fixedly connected, the bottom plate 1 plays a supportive role to the supporting rod 21, and it is logical that first is provided on the supporting rod 21 Hole 211, the first through hole 211 are square hole hole and the left and right surface through the supporting rod 21.The holder 22 is bending, The both ends of the holder 22 are fixedly connected with the supporting rod 21, and the supporting rod 21 plays a supportive role to the holder 22, institute It states and is provided with the second through-hole 221 on holder 22, second through-hole 221 is square hole and the left and right surface through the holder 22. Described first smooth piece 23 for cuboid and it is vertical place, described first smooth piece 23 be contained in second through-hole 221 and It is fixedly connected with the holder 22, described first smooth piece 23 is made of lubricious material, you can to reduce frictional force.Described first Support plate 24 is cuboid and horizontal positioned, the lower surface fixation company of the upper end of the supporting rod 21 and first support plate 24 It connects, the supporting rod 21 plays a supportive role to first support plate 24.Second support plate 25 is cuboid and level is put It sets, the left surface of second support plate 25 is fixedly connected with the holder 22, and the holder 22 is to second support plate 25 It plays a supportive role.
As shown in Figure 1, the electric cylinders device 3 includes electric cylinders 31, the push rod 32 being set in the electric cylinders 31, is set to institute State the connecting rod 33 on push rod 32.The electric cylinders 31 and power supply electric connection (not shown), electric energy, the electric cylinders 31 are provided for it On be provided with switch (not shown), facilitate control its opening and closing, the electric cylinders 31 and the upper surface of second support plate 25 are fixed Connection, second support plate 25 play a supportive role to the electric cylinders 31.The push rod 32 is horizon bar, the right side of the push rod 32 End is connect with the electric cylinders 31 so that the electric cylinders 31 can drive the push rod 32 to move left and right, and the push rod 32 runs through institute State first smooth piece 23 of left and right surface and with described first smooth piece of 23 sliding contact, described first smooth piece 23 so that described The level that push rod 32 can be stablized on described first smooth piece 23 moves left and right, and the push rod 32 passes through the first through hole 211.The connecting rod 33 is brace, and the upper end of the connecting rod 33 is provided with the first groove, and the lower end of the connecting rod 33 is set It is equipped with the second groove, the left end of the push rod 32 is contained in first groove and is pivotally connected with the connecting rod 33, made Obtaining the connecting rod 44 can be with relative rotation with the push rod 32.
As shown in Figure 1, the electric machine 4 includes motor 41, be set to the lower section of the motor 41 second smooth piece 42, The rotary shaft 43 being set on the motor 41, the grinding block 44 being set to below the rotary shaft 43.The motor 41 and electricity Source is (not shown) to be electrically connected, and provides electric energy for it, switch (not shown) is provided on the motor 41, facilitating control, it is opened It closes, the motor 41 is fixedly connected with the lower surface of first support plate 24, and first support plate 24 is to the motor 41 It plays a supportive role.Described second smooth piece 42 is cylinder and horizontal positioned, second smooth piece 42 of the upper surface with it is described Motor 41 is fixedly connected, and described second smooth piece 42 is made of lubricious material, can reduce frictional force.The rotary shaft 43 is circle Cylinder and it is vertical place, the rotary shaft 43 through described second smooth piece 42 upper and lower surface and with described second smooth piece 42 Sliding contact, the upper end of the rotary shaft 43 are connect with the motor 41 so that the motor 41 can drive the rotary shaft 43 rotations, described second smooth piece 42 so that the rotation that the rotary shaft 43 is stablized on described second smooth piece 42.It is described to grind Abrading block 44 is in round estrade, and the lower end of the rotary shaft 43 is fixedly connected with the upper surface of the grinding block 44, the rotary shaft 43 The grinding block 44 can be driven to rotate, the grinding block 44 can play the role of grinding to chalk end.
As shown in Figure 1, the frame device 5 includes transverse slat 51, the smooth plate 52 being set on the transverse slat 51, is set to Framework 53 on the smooth plate 52, the link block 54 for being set to 53 right side of the framework, be contained in it is convex in the framework 53 Block 55, be set to the top of the convex block 55 into material frame 56, the cross bar 57 that is set to 53 left side of the framework, be set to the cross The spring 58 of 57 lower section of bar.The transverse slat 51 is cuboid, and the right surface of the transverse slat 51 is fixedly connected with the supporting rod 21, The supporting rod 21 plays a supportive role to the transverse slat 51, and third through-hole 511, the third through-hole are provided on the transverse slat 51 511 upper and lower surface for square hole and through the transverse slat 51.The smooth plate 52 is cuboid and horizontal positioned, the smooth plate 52 are contained in the third through-hole 511 and are fixedly connected with the transverse slat 51, and the smooth plate 52 is made of lubricious material, i.e., Frictional force can be reduced.The framework 53 is that hollow cylinder and upper and lower surface communicate, and the framework 53 is through described smooth The upper and lower surface of plate 52 and with 52 sliding contact of the smooth plate, the smooth plate 52 so that the framework 53 in the smooth plate That stablizes on 52 moves up and down, and the grinding block 44 is contained in the framework 53 and is connect with the sliding of the inner surface of the framework 53 It touches so that the grinding block 44 can the rotation in the framework 53.The left surface of the link block 54 is solid with the framework 53 Fixed connection, the link block 54 are contained in second groove and are pivotally connected with the connecting rod 33 so that the connection Bar 33 can be with relative rotation with the link block 54, and then the push rod 32 passes through the connecting rod 33 and 54 band of the link block The dynamic framework 53 is vertical to be moved up and down.The convex block 55 is cylinder, and 55 side of the convex block is interior with the framework 53 Surface is fixedly connected, and third groove 551 is provided on the upper surface of the convex block 55, is provided on the lower surface of the convex block 55 4th groove 552, the third groove 551 are cylinder, and the 4th groove 552 is round estrade, and the third groove 551 It is communicated with the 4th groove 552, the grinding block 44 can be contained in the 4th groove 552 and match with the convex block 55 Close the grinding realized to chalk end.Described into material frame 56 be that hollow round estrade and upper and lower surface communicate, described into material frame 56 It third groove 551 described in lower end aligned and is fixedly connected with the upper surface of the convex block 55 so that the inside into material frame 56 It is communicated with the third groove 551.The right end of the cross bar 57 is fixedly connected with the framework 53, and the cross bar 57 is to the frame Body 53 plays a supportive role.The spring 58 is vertical placement, and the upper end of the spring 58 is fixedly connected with the cross bar 57, described The lower end of spring 58 is fixedly connected with the upper surface of the transverse slat 51, and the transverse slat 51 plays a supportive role to the spring 58, institute It states spring 58 to play a supportive role to the cross bar 57, the spring 58 can prevent the framework with 57 collective effect of the cross bar 53 excessive move up and down.
As shown in Figure 1, the discarded chalk end recycling equipment of the present invention environmental protection is in use, first by discarded powder Nib is poured into described into material frame 56, and discarded chalk end enters the 4th groove 552 by the third groove 551 It is interior, and on the side in the grinding block 44, then open the switch of the motor 41 so that the motor 41 drives described The rotation that rotary shaft 43 is stablized, the rotary shaft 43 drive the grinding block 44 to rotate, open simultaneously the switch of the electric cylinders 31, So that the electric cylinders 31 drive being moved to the left for the stabilization of the push rod 32, and then the upper end of the connecting rod 33 is in the push rod 32 Left end rotate counterclockwise, the connecting rod 33 is so that the link block 54, the framework 53 move down, and then the spring 58 are compressed so that the acting against on chalk end tightly of the convex block 55, the cooperation of the grinding block 44 with rotation are realized to powder The attrition grinding of nib, after grinding, the electric cylinders 31 make the push rod 32 move right, the upper end of the connecting rod 33 Left end around the push rod 32 rotates clockwise, the connecting rod 33 so that the link block 54, the framework 53 to moving up Dynamic, the compressed spring 58 also pushes up the framework 53, until the lower end of the grinding block 44 is in the framework 53 lower section, at this point, the chalk dust after being ground on 44 side of the grinding block is fallen in the collection center 11, to convenient pair It is recycled, high degree of automation, and hand labor intensity is small.So far, the discarded chalk end recycling equipment of present invention environmental protection It is told about and is finished using process.
